cement / pavement will make a difference
air temp,
humidity, etc.
the computer has a "torque management" feature, which sucks, but it prevents breaks and harshness on the car. This feature can be disabled but its not recommended. I had mine lowered to 50% ... ls1's come with it set at 100% or so.
So whenever the computer thinks its a good time to lower the torque numbers, it does so accordingly.00 Z28 M6 T-tops
